Market Sizing, Growth Estimates, and CAGR Projections

Based on current industry data, the South Korea EPM/EPDM O-Rings market was valued at approximately USD 350 million in 2023. This valuation considers the robust automotive, manufacturing, and electronics sectors, which are primary consumers of high-performance sealing solutions. Assuming a conservative comp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.5% over the next five years, driven by increasing demand for durable, temperature-resistant elastomers, the market is projected to reach around USD 470 million by 2028.

Key assumptions underpinning these projections include:

  • Steady industrial output growth in South Korea (~3-4% annually), bolstered by government initiatives supporting manufacturing and exports.
  • Growing adoption of EPDM-based O-Rings in automotive and industrial applications due to superior weather, ozone, and chemical resistance.
  • Incremental penetration into emerging sectors such as renewable energy, electronics, and infrastructure.

Value Chain Analysis & Revenue Models

The value chain encompasses:

  1. Raw Material Sourcing:

    Ethylene, propylene, and specialty elastomers procured from global petrochemical giants and regional suppliers, with an emphasis on quality and cost-efficiency.

  2. Manufacturing & Processing:

    Conversion of raw elastomers into O-Rings via extrusion, compression molding, or injection molding, often incorporating proprietary formulations for enhanced performance.

  3. Quality Control & Certification:

    Rigorous testing for dimensional accuracy, chemical resistance, and durability, complying with ISO, ASTM, and industry-specific standards.

  4. Distribution & Logistics:

    Multi-channel distribution including OEM direct supply, regional distributors, and online platforms, optimized for just-in-time delivery.

  5. End-User Application & Lifecycle Services:

    Installation, maintenance, and replacement services, with revenue derived from product sales, technical support, and aftermarket services.

The revenue model primarily hinges on product sales, complemented by value-added services such as custom engineering, technical consulting, and extended warranties, fostering long-term customer relationships and recurring revenue streams.

Cost Structures, Pricing Strategies, and Investment Patterns

The cost structure involves:

  • Raw Material Costs:

    Approximately 40-50% of manufacturing expenses, influenced by petrochemical prices and supply chain dynamics.

  • Manufacturing & Processing:

    Capital investments in high-precision molding equipment, automation, and quality testing facilities.

  • Labor & Overheads:

    Skilled labor for R&D, quality assurance, and production management.

  • Distribution & Logistics:

    Costs vary based on regional logistics complexity and inventory management strategies.

Pricing strategies focus on value-based pricing for high-performance and customized products, with competitive pricing for standard offerings. Premium pricing is maintained for technologically advanced or proprietary formulations.
